I currently own one of these car and thought i'd add my 2 cent as a small review. I bought an AstraTwinTop1.6 Sport in July 2007, so have a slightly different view from the other (superb) review on this car.

When I first drove this car i was amazed how it felt like a normal car, if you didnt know it was a convertible you wouldn't guess from inside. I was lucky to be able to try the roof down when i bought it, so of course straight away tried the fold up design. I actually tried this while driving, and had no problems at all with it, the manual says to keep under 20mph when operating the roof, so i was going about 18mph. Once the top was down, it was great, All the windows came down and I was cruising!!

The car handles pretty well around city area's but being a 1.6 you dont get that extra pull when putting your foot down. If I had the choice again i would definitly go for a 1.8 minimum. Being a convertible makes the car heavier than other cars, so you need that bit of extra power.

I currently get about 400 miles to a full tank, which works out at about 31 miles to the gallon. This is very poor, but I am only driving in built up area's so its expected to be a bit lower. When I have gone on longer journey's the milage does go up to about 475 to a full tank. Of course convertibles arn't known for their great miles to the gallon.

6 months down the line i'm still glad i bought this car instead of a bog standard Astra, but would definitly go for a more powerful engine next time.

There are 4 different types of twiptop available

Astra TwinTop (basic car, no trip computer, cannot operate roof with remote)
Astra TwinTop Sport (Trip computer, remote operation included, front fog lights)
Astra TwinTop Design (all of above, including leather seats, 18" Alloys, Cruise control, and more..)
Astra TwinTop Exclusv Black (Same as design but in black with a few extra features)
